Gary Trent Jr. is an American professional basketball player, currently playing as a shooting guard for the Milwaukee Bucks in the NBA. Born on January 18, 1999, in Columbus, Ohio, he stands 6 feet 5 inches tall and weighs 204 pounds.
Early Career:
- Portland Trail Blazers (2018–2021): Trent Jr. was selected by the Sacramento Kings as the 37th overall pick in the 2018 NBA Draft but was traded to the Portland Trail Blazers. Over his three seasons with Portland, his performance improved significantly, culminating in a career-high 44-point game against the Cleveland Cavaliers in April 2021.
- Toronto Raptors (2021–2024): In March 2021, he was traded to the Toronto Raptors. Trent Jr. had several standout performances, including multiple 30-point games and a career-high 42-point game against the Houston Rockets in February 2022.
Milwaukee Bucks (2024–Present):
- In July 2024, Trent Jr. signed a one-year contract with the Milwaukee Bucks. He reunited with former Portland teammate Damian Lillard and has contributed significantly off the bench. Notably, in February 2025, he led the Bucks with 21 points in a win over the Minnesota Timberwolves.
2024–2025 Season Performance:
- As of March 2025, Trent Jr. is averaging 10.8 points, 2.3 rebounds, and 1.2 assists per game, with a field goal percentage of 43.8%.
